The United States Department of Agriculture will experience a change in leadership when the Trump Administration takes over control of the White House and both chambers of congress in January 2025. Before he leaves, current Farm Service Agency Administrator and South Dakota rancher Zach Ducheneaux says he has work he wants to take care of before he leaves the job.

Red meat exports have been strong for the United States in 2024, despite volatility and serious headwinds in major Asian markets. U.S. Meat Export Federation President and CEO Dan Halstrom says pork is doing especially well and beef isn't far behind.

Fertilizer is a major input cost for many American farmers and global instability is causing a strain on the available supply. In this episode, the CEO of a cooperative in South Dakota and North Dakota talks about the current situation and the difference a recent USDA Rural Development grant will make for their customers.

There are seven ballot measures on South Dakota’s Nov. 5, 2024, general election ballot and at least half of them have some sort of verbiage disagreement between the proponents and the opponents. The result puts voters in the middle trying to sort through messages that spin one way or another to find information. One of the issues is Referred Law 21. The South Dakota Farmers Union organization is urging people to vote against it, while the South Dakota Corn Growers organization is urging people to support it. In this podcast, you'll hear from SD Corn Growers Executive Director DaNita Murray and SD Farmers Union President Doug Sombke.
